Katie Couric's dream sitcom?
Katie Couric recently claimed that the Ground Zero mosque controversy had exposed a "seething hatred" for Muslims in America. She added that she thinks there may need to be a Muslim version of "The Cosby Show."

"'The Cosby Show' did so much to change attitudes about African-Americans in this country, and I think sometimes people are afraid of what they don't understand," she said.

Such a show is already live and going strong in Canada. It's not a new show, it's already in its fifth season: a sitcom called "Little Mosque on the Prairie" about the trials of a new imam as he and his mosque attempt to assimilate their Islamic religion into the Anglican town of Mercy. It is a popular show, but whether any hearts or minds are changed is another matter.
